Transaction 3a51cc23e1744a01fd2ee6d51a2c00b20c49e13af1482f198e8f82cfd0458faf
1 Input
2 Outputs
- 3a51cc23e1744a01fd2ee6d51a2c00b20c49e13af1482f198e8f82cfd0458faf:0
- 3a51cc23e1744a01fd2ee6d51a2c00b20c49e13af1482f198e8f82cfd0458faf:1
value 3176
address 18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
value 314405
address 3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X